Comment obtenir le line-up parfait pour votre conférence ?
Conseils pratiques pour constituer un programme de qualité pour une conférence tech, basés sur l'expérience de l'auteur en tant qu'organisateur et intervenant.
Conseils pratiques pour constituer un programme de qualité pour une conférence tech, basés sur l'expérience de l'auteur en tant qu'organisateur et intervenant.
Explains how modern AI agents acquire new capabilities by learning to use and combine tools like programming routines to solve complex tasks autonomously.
L'article explore l'évolution de l'informatique personnelle, de la programmation créative des débuts à la démocratisation des interfaces graphiques.
Explique les trois types de messages en programmation (commandes, requêtes, événements) et l'importance de leur nommage.
L'article explore l'impact de l'IA sur le métier de développeur, argumentant que les emplois ne disparaîtront pas mais évolueront radicalement.
Explique la différence entre DateTime et DateTimeImmutable en PHP, leurs comportements (mutable vs immuable) et recommande d'utiliser DateTimeImmutable.
Guide pour résoudre l'erreur PHPUnit 10 dans Symfony en modifiant le script bin/phpunit après la suppression de PHPUnit\TextUI\Command.
Benchmark comparant les performances de WebAssembly et JavaScript pour un traitement d'image (décalage de teinte).
Récit d'un développeur sur un entretien technique marathon de 7h, avec conseils pour se préparer et réussir.
Comparaison des meilleurs IDE et éditeurs de texte pour développeurs, avec des recommandations par langage et OS.
Guide comparant les différentes voies d'études (Bac, BTS, BUT, Licence, Bachelor) pour devenir développeur web ou logiciel, avec des conseils sur les formations reconnues.
Introduction aux design patterns (patrons de conception) en développement logiciel : leur utilité, leur importance pour la communication et la résolution de problèmes récurrents.
L'auteur partage des exemples de code mal écrits ("sataneries") et explique comment les éviter avec de bonnes pratiques de programmation.
L'article présente une technique personnelle de résolution de problèmes en programmation, inspirée de l'expérience et du livre "How To Solve It".
Un développeur partage les apprentissages décisifs qui ont transformé sa carrière, notamment l'importance de comprendre profondément le contexte technique avant de coder.
Un développeur partage son expérience en tant que formateur en développement web pour un BTS, abordant les qualités nécessaires, les avantages et les défis de l'enseignement.
Présentation de trois livres essentiels pour améliorer ses compétences en développement logiciel, dont Clean Code.
L'auteur participe à une émission en stream pour développer un jeu GameBoy en direct, en partant de zéro avec des outils et des bases de programmation.
Découvrez une règle simple pour améliorer vos compétences en développement, présentée dans une vidéo YouTube.
Guide complet pour devenir développeur web freelance : statuts, plateformes, tarifs et conseils pratiques pour se lancer en indépendant.